Solution Overview

Problem

Existing techniques for personalizing wellness coaching on electronic devices are cumbersome and inefficient, often requiring complex user interfaces and self-identification of relevant activities, leading to wasted user time and device energy.

Innovation Solution

The method involves displaying a first wellness-related action to a user, detecting if the action is not completed, and replacing it with a new action that meets different action-selection criteria, thereby optimizing user interaction and device efficiency.

Data Source

PatentUS20250069740A1Methods and user interfaces for personalized wellness coaching
Publication Date: 2025.02.27 APPLE INC
